Mission & Interests
Goals: EuroTEST provides a European platform for information exchange and activities to improve early diagnosis and care of HIV, Viral Hepatitis, Sexually Transmitted Infections and Tuberculosis.
The EuroTEST initiative is involved in various projects and collaborations within infectious disease testing and linkage to care with partners throughout Europe.
The overall objective of EuroTEST is to ensure that people living with HIV, Viral Hepatitis, STIs or TB have access to testing and enter care earlier in the course of their infection than is currently the case, as well as to study the decrease in the proportion presenting late for care.
The EuroTEST initiative is governed by an independent Steering Committee (SC). The conditions of funding the initiative are approved by the SC. Industry sponsors are not part of the SC and do not have any influence on the projects and initiatives implemented by EuroTEST.

Info Members: Paid staff are working in the EuroTEST secretariat and are coordinating the different activities under EuroTEST like the European Testing Week and liaising with the different collaborators.

Is Member Of: European AIDS Treatment Group (EATG) is functioning as the policy secretariat of EuroTEST. Through EATG EuroTEST is affiliated with the Civil Society Forum on HIV,TB and Hep.
EuroTEST is on some projects working together with European AIDS Clinical Society.
